Two South Korean marines killed in border clash



Two South Korean marines have been killed and at least 16 wounded in an artillery exchange at Yeonpyeong island.

The island is home to a large South Korean military base and lies around 3000 metres south of the disputed Yellow Sea area. South Korea said that around 50 artillery shells landed on the island, killing two soldiers and wounding over a dozen. The South Korean military had been conducting what it describes as "exercises" around the island earlier in the day and the North claimed that the South was responsible for opening hostilities. Seoul has dismissed Pyongyang's claim, saying that they were fired on first. The South responded by firing over 80 shells - there are no reported casualties on the Northern side.

It has also come to light that the North has shown of a Uranium enrichment facility to a US scientist. The Uranium could be used to make nuclear weapons.

South Korea has threatened missile strikes agains the North should there be any further clashes.

Shots fired across Korean border



Shots have been fired across the Korean border in a further escalation of hostilities between the rival states.

South Korea has claimed that two shots were fired at one of their frontline units in Hwacheon. The South Korean military then responded with three rounds. There were no injuries. So far North Korea has not made any statement regarding the incident.

The incident is believed to have been the first cross border shooting in four years, although confrontations at sea are common. Tensions between the two rivals have been high since the South accused the North of torpedoing one of its warships in March, with the loss of 46 lives. Pyongyang denies the charge.
